Restoring Communication: How Relationship Counseling Houston Helps Couples Reconnect

Communication is the cornerstone of any successful relationship. Yet, for many couples, it’s the first thing to break down during times of stress. Misunderstandings, hurtful comments, and emotional distance can create a communication barrier that feels impossible to overcome. This is where relationship counseling in Houston steps in.

Relationship counselors are trained to help couples rebuild communication from the ground up. In many cases, couples believe they are communicating, but in reality, they’re talking past each other—failing to truly listen and understand. Counselors use specific techniques like active listening exercises, which teach couples how to truly hear one another without jumping to conclusions or getting defensive.

Example:
Consider a couple who constantly argues about finances. The wife may feel her concerns about money are being ignored, while the husband feels criticized for his spending habits. In counseling, the wife learns to express her concerns in a way that doesn’t feel like an attack, while the husband learns to listen without becoming defensive. This simple shift in communication can drastically change the dynamic of their conversations.

Nonviolent communication is another powerful tool used in relationship counseling. This technique encourages partners to express their needs and feelings without resorting to blame or criticism. Instead of saying, “You never listen to me,” a partner might say, “I feel unheard when I talk about my day.” This approach helps both partners feel more connected and understood, reducing the likelihood of arguments.

Ultimately, relationship counseling in Houston helps couples break down the barriers that have been built through years of miscommunication. By restoring open, honest dialogue, couples can rediscover the connection that brought them together in the first place.

Navigating Conflict: The Role of Relationship Counseling Houston in Resolving Disagreements

Conflict is inevitable in any relationship. However, it’s how couples handle conflict that determines whether their relationship will thrive or deteriorate. For many couples, conflicts escalate into damaging arguments that leave both partners feeling hurt, misunderstood, and resentful. This is where relationship counseling in Houston proves invaluable.

One of the key focuses of relationship counseling is teaching couples how to navigate conflict in a healthy and productive way. Counselors often introduce techniques such as conflict mapping, where couples identify the root cause of their disagreements and work through them systematically. For example, a couple may argue about household chores, but the real issue might be a deeper feeling of imbalance in the relationship.

Another important aspect of conflict resolution is learning how to fight fairly. Many couples engage in conflict with the goal of “winning” the argument, but this competitive mindset only breeds resentment. Counselors teach couples that the goal of conflict resolution isn’t to win but to understand and collaborate.

Example:
A Houston couple might argue about how to discipline their children. Through counseling, they learn to express their differing opinions without resorting to accusations or ultimatums. Instead, they begin to view the conflict as an opportunity to find common ground and make decisions as a team.

Counselors also equip couples with tools to manage emotions during conflict. Techniques like taking a “time-out” when emotions run high allow couples to step away, collect their thoughts, and return to the conversation when they’re ready to communicate calmly. This prevents arguments from escalating into full-blown fights, preserving the relationship’s emotional safety.

Through relationship counseling in Houston, couples learn to approach conflict not as a threat to their relationship but as an opportunity for growth and deeper understanding.

Building Trust: The Transformative Power of Relationship Counseling Houston

Trust is the foundation of any strong relationship. However, trust can be fragile—especially after betrayals, dishonesty, or broken promises. When trust is damaged, it can feel like there’s no way to repair the relationship. However, relationship counseling in Houston offers a path to healing and rebuilding trust.

One of the first steps in rebuilding trust is acknowledging the hurt that has been caused. In counseling, both partners are encouraged to express their emotions openly and honestly, while the counselor facilitates a safe space for these difficult conversations. This process helps both partners gain a deeper understanding of the impact of their actions, paving the way for forgiveness and healing.

Counselors also guide couples through trust-building exercises designed to restore emotional safety in the relationship. These exercises might involve increasing transparency, setting new boundaries, or engaging in small actions that rebuild trust over time. For example, a couple recovering from infidelity might agree to be more open about their schedules or limit interactions with individuals who could be a threat to the relationship.

Forgiveness is another crucial aspect of rebuilding trust. While it can be difficult, forgiveness is essential for moving forward. Relationship counseling helps couples navigate the complex emotions surrounding forgiveness, ensuring that it’s a genuine and healing process rather than a superficial one.

Over time, with the support of a counselor, couples can rebuild trust and create a stronger, more resilient relationship. While it may be a slow process, the result is a relationship that is even stronger than before.
